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Boa noite a todos. Direto ao ponto. Pessoal o codigo abaixo exibe na tela o item que foi selecionado.
Gostaria que continuasse exibindo normalmente na tela, mas sem carregar a página.
<?php
error_reporting(0);
ini_set("display_errors", 0 );
?>
EX 1
<form id="frm" name="form1" method="post" action="">
<select name="cursos" required onchange="onSelectChange();">
<option value="" ></option>
<option value="php" <?php if($_POST['cursos'] == 'php'){ echo 'selected'; } ?> >php</option>
<option value="css" <?php if($_POST['cursos'] == 'css'){ echo 'selected'; } ?> >css</option>
</select>
</form>
<script>
function onSelectChange(){
document.getElementById('frm').submit();
}
</script>
<?php
if (isset($_POST["cursos"])){
if ($_POST['cursos'] == 'php'){
echo 'voce selecionou php';
}
elseif ($_POST['cursos'] == 'css'){
echo 'voce selecionou css';
}
}
?>Carregando comentários...